WorkflowControlClient Constructores
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Inicializa una nueva instancia de la clase WorkflowControlClient.
Sobrecargas
| Nombre | Description |
|---|---|
| WorkflowControlClient() |
Inicializa una nueva instancia de la clase WorkflowControlClient. |
| WorkflowControlClient(WorkflowControlEndpoint) |
Inicializa una nueva instancia de la WorkflowControlClient clase con el especificado WorkflowControlEndpoint. |
| WorkflowControlClient(String) |
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ración de punto de conexión especificada. |
| WorkflowControlClient(Binding, EndpointAddress) |
Inicializa una nueva instancia de la WorkflowControlClient clase con el enlace especificado y WorkflowControlEndpoint. |
| WorkflowControlClient(String, EndpointAddress) |
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ración de punto de conexión especificada y EndpointAddress. |
| WorkflowControlClient(String, String) |
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ración del punto de conexión y la dirección de punto de conexión especificados. |
WorkflowControlClient()
Inicializa una nueva instancia de la clase WorkflowControlClient.
public:
WorkflowControlClient();
public WorkflowControlClient();
Public Sub New ()
Se aplica a
WorkflowControlClient(WorkflowControlEndpoint)
Inicializa una nueva instancia de la WorkflowControlClient clase con el especificado WorkflowControlEndpoint.
public:
WorkflowControlClient(System::ServiceModel::Activities::WorkflowControlEndpoint ^ workflowEndpoint);
public WorkflowControlClient(System.ServiceModel.Activities.WorkflowControlEndpoint workflowEndpoint);
new System.ServiceModel.Activities.WorkflowControlClient : System.ServiceModel.Activities.WorkflowControlEndpoint -> System.ServiceModel.Activities.WorkflowControlClient
Public Sub New (workflowEndpoint As WorkflowControlEndpoint)
Parámetros
- workflowEndpoint
- WorkflowControlEndpoint
Punto de conexión de control de flujo de trabajo.
Ejemplos
En el ejemplo siguiente se muestra cómo crear una WorkflowControlClient instancia mediante este constructor.
WorkflowControlEndpoint wce = new WorkflowControlEndpoint(new BasicHttpBinding(), new EndpointAddress(new Uri("http://localhost/DataflowControl.xaml")));
WorkflowControlClient controlClient = new WorkflowControlClient(wce);
Se aplica a
WorkflowControlClient(String)
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ración de punto de conexión especificada.
public:
WorkflowControlClient(System::String ^ endpointConfigurationName);
public WorkflowControlClient(string endpointConfigurationName);
new System.ServiceModel.Activities.WorkflowControlClient : string -> System.ServiceModel.Activities.WorkflowControlClient
Public Sub New (endpointConfigurationName As String)
Parámetros
- endpointConfigurationName
- String
Configuración que se va a usar.
Ejemplos
En el ejemplo siguiente se muestra cómo usar este constructor.
WorkflowControlClient controlClient = new WorkflowControlClient("ConfigName");
Se aplica a
WorkflowControlClient(Binding, EndpointAddress)
Inicializa una nueva instancia de la WorkflowControlClient clase con el enlace especificado y WorkflowControlEndpoint.
public:
WorkflowControlClient(System::ServiceModel::Channels::Binding ^ binding, System::ServiceModel::EndpointAddress ^ remoteAddress);
public WorkflowControlClient(System.ServiceModel.Channels.Binding binding, System.ServiceModel.EndpointAddress remoteAddress);
new System.ServiceModel.Activities.WorkflowControlClient : System.ServiceModel.Channels.Binding * System.ServiceModel.EndpointAddress -> System.ServiceModel.Activities.WorkflowControlClient
Public Sub New (binding As Binding, remoteAddress As EndpointAddress)
Parámetros
- binding
- Binding
Enlace.
- remoteAddress
- EndpointAddress
Punto de conexión de control de flujo de trabajo.
Ejemplos
En el ejemplo siguiente se muestra cómo usar este constructor.
IWorkflowCreation creationClient = new ChannelFactory<IWorkflowCreation>(new BasicHttpBinding(), "http://localhost/DataflowControl.xaml/Creation").CreateChannel();
// Start a new instance of the workflow
Guid instanceId = creationClient.CreateSuspended(null);
WorkflowControlClient controlClient = new WorkflowControlClient(
new BasicHttpBinding(),
new EndpointAddress(new Uri("http://localhost/DataflowControl.xaml")));
controlClient.Unsuspend(instanceId);
Se aplica a
WorkflowControlClient(String, EndpointAddress)
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ración de punto de conexión especificada y EndpointAddress.
public:
WorkflowControlClient(System::String ^ endpointConfigurationName, System::ServiceModel::EndpointAddress ^ remoteAddress);
public WorkflowControlClient(string endpointConfigurationName, System.ServiceModel.EndpointAddress remoteAddress);
new System.ServiceModel.Activities.WorkflowControlClient : string * System.ServiceModel.EndpointAddress -> System.ServiceModel.Activities.WorkflowControlClient
Public Sub New (endpointConfigurationName As String, remoteAddress As EndpointAddress)
Parámetros
- endpointConfigurationName
- String
Configuración del punto de conexión.
- remoteAddress
- EndpointAddress
Dirección del punto de conexión.
Ejemplos
En el ejemplo siguiente se muestra cómo usar este constructor.
WorkflowControlClient controlClient = new WorkflowControlClient("ConfigName", new EndpointAddress(new Uri("http://localhost/DataflowControl.xaml")));
Se aplica a
WorkflowControlClient(String, String)
Inicializa una nueva instancia de la WorkflowControlClient clase con la configuración del punto de conexión y la dirección de punto de conexión especificados.
public:
WorkflowControlClient(System::String ^ endpointConfigurationName, System::String ^ remoteAddress);
public WorkflowControlClient(string endpointConfigurationName, string remoteAddress);
new System.ServiceModel.Activities.WorkflowControlClient : string * string -> System.ServiceModel.Activities.WorkflowControlClient
Public Sub New (endpointConfigurationName As String, remoteAddress As String)
Parámetros
- endpointConfigurationName
- String
Configuración del punto de conexión.
- remoteAddress
- String
Dirección del punto de conexión.
Ejemplos
En el ejemplo siguiente se muestra cómo usar este constructor.
WorkflowControlClient controlClient = new WorkflowControlClient("ConfigName", "http://localhost/DataflowControl.xaml");